Abstract

Throughout human history natural products have been used as remedies to cure or treat various diseases. Even traditionally it has been surpassed by the amazing technology and pharmaceutical development that emerged with the promise of early healing. Humans continue to be affected by various diseases, mainly due to natural forces such as drug resistant microbes and insects.  Consequently, an imperative need exists to connect the ethno pharmacological information with the newest drug discovery new active natural metabolites. Hence, it an urgent need to screen and isolate new natural products from plant sources and search for novel leads as therapeutic targets for future. Further, novel isolates and active fractions will also be part of active diet to enhance the health and lifestyle. Therefore, in present work attempts were made to search for new isolates with potential efficaciesviz. antioxidant, chemo preventive , cardio preventive, cardio protective and dietary supplement, among these our research attempts were made to isolation of lupeol from D. rubrum  and its quantification. Lupeol exhibits a broad spectrum of biological activities and can be used as chemo preventive to avoid several diseases. Screening of lupeol suggested that it has positive potentials as anti HIV drug.
